- [ ] **Step 7: Breaker override escrow.** After sealing the signing keys for the Tallgrove upstream API circuit breaker, confirm the support team can force the breaker open during a full outage. The override bundle lives in the sealed escrow drawer and is useless without its unlock phrase. Two ceremony witnesses must initial this step before proceeding. The escrow bundle is decrypted with the recovery passphrase that follows.

vault phrase of kahip-kahop = holath-quenmir

Hey — handing off GraphTangle before I'm out. The dep-graph visualizer is mostly quiet, but the layout workers occasionally OOM on the Brindlewood monorepo; just restart them, they resume from the snapshot. Don't touch the edge cache during business hours, it takes ages to warm. Renders over 50k nodes get queued to the slow pool automatically. If you need to redeploy, the current prod settings are as follows.

config for bawep-faduf:
OLIATH_HOST=oliath.qorvellabs.internal
OLIATH_PORT=9000

FINANCE REVIEW SUMMARY — Prepared for the Incoming Director

The new Meridian Plus subscription tier launched last quarter at Corvell Media. Uptake reached 8% of the active base, slightly ahead of model. Margin per subscriber is up 12%; support costs are flat. Pricing holds through year-end. Strategic context is provided in the note below.

board note of kageg-bahof: The renewal with Holwynax Holdings closes at $2 million a year, 5 percent below the last contract. Project Ulaath slips by two quarters because of the supplier delay.

Vendor note: Gristmill's per-tenant rate quotas

Quick heads-up for the review — Gristmill enforces quotas at their edge, not ours, so a misconfigured tenant could theoretically starve neighbors before our throttles kick in. They've promised quota audit exports quarterly, and we've asked for alerting on quota overrides. Contract renewal is in Q3, so flag concerns early. To request their latest quota config dump, write to their account liaison.

billing contact of yawip-yadup = druath.casdor@nelvrolabs.internal

## Changelog — Renderfarm Quill v4.2

Renamed `TRANSCODE_AUTH` to `QUILL_FARM_TOKEN` across all encoder nodes. The old name is ignored as of this release, so stale configs will fail silently at queue pickup. If a node stops claiming transcode jobs after upgrade, update its env file so it contains the following line:

sealed setting: ARCHIVE_KEY3=8d0